Brown Marmorated Stink Bug

Halyomorpha halys

Order & Family
Hemiptera: Pentatomidae
Size
12-17 mm (approx. 0.5-0.7 inches)

Natural Habitat

Agricultural fields, orchards, gardens, and urban structures during winter

Diet & Feeding

Herbivorous; feeds on a wide range of fruits, vegetables, and ornamental plants using piercing-sucking mouthparts

Behavior Patterns

Diurnal; known for overwintering inside buildings and releasing a strong defensive odor from thoracic glands when threatened or crushed

Risks & Benefits

Major agricultural pest that causes significant crop damage; nuisance to homeowners but does not bite or spread disease to humans
